The issues addressed are as follows: Link state computation: - Diverging logic for selecting a link configuration for eDP, DP SST, and DP MST, for both non-DSC and DSC cases. Link training fallback: - Diverging policies for selecting fallback link configurations after link training failures for eDP, DP SST, and DP MST. - Inflexible fallback selection, setting a maximum link rate/lane count for subsequent modesets, preventing the use of link configurations that have not failed during link training and so could still work. - eDP and DP SST fallback order not compliant with the DP standard, using a descending lane/rate order instead of bandwidth order. - eDP and DP SST fallback lane/rate order not matching the link state compuation's rate/lane order. - The above inflexible fallback order resulting in inconsistent reporting of the valid connector modes for eDP and DP SST after a link training failure. Modes may disappear and reappear during the fallback sequence. Link training recovery: - Unclear semantics between driver-driven and userspace-driven recovery. - Unclear distinction between modeset failures and actual link training failures during automatic retraining, and lack of proper handling of the former. Interaction of link state computation, fallback and recovery: - Handling of the supported-, allowed-, forced-, fallback-link configurations, and link recovery decisions are intertwined across multiple modules with direct access/mutation of the relevant state, instead of having clear interfaces for these. - Lack of documentation and unit test coverage for the handling of link-capabilities, -configurations and for the fallback/recovery logic. This patchset addresses the above primarily by introducing a central link capability module (intel_dp_link_caps.c) and restructuring the detection of link capabilities, link state computation, fallback and recovery to query and adjust link configurations exclusively via that interface. The current behavior is preserved for both modeset state computation and link training fallback/recovery logic. For now this patchset will enable setting a particular link configuration ordering on a per-connector basis (both as a default based on the connector type and as a dynamic setting); that in turn allows - as a follow-up to this patchset - to switch over to a unified, bandwidth-based fallback policy by simply changing the ordering for a given connector type. The changes in more detail are (everywhere assuming the switch-over to the new scheme as a follow-up based on the above): Link state computation: - Unify link configuration selection logic for eDP, DP SST, and DP MST, for both non-DSC and DSC cases, using the same interface to query and adjust the allowed link configuration set, using the same configuration ordering for this. Link training fallback: - Unified fallback selection mechanism across connector types, matching the mechanism of the link state computation phase. - Enable a more fine-grained fallback policy by disabling only the link configuration that failed link training, preserving the rest for subsequent modesets. - Align fallback ordering with that of the link state computation. - Ensure a consistent view of supported connector modes across fallback sequences. Link training recovery: - Clarify and separate driver-driven and userspace-driven recovery semantics, and document these. - Distinguish modeset failures from link training failures during automatic retraining and handle modeset failures appropriately. Interaction of link state computation, fallback and recovery: - Separate the tracking of supported link configurations - based on the sink's detected capabilities - and selection of fallback configurations into their dedicated modules, with a well-defined interface to query and adjust the configurations available for a modeset: Detection Computation (intel_dp.c) | | | adjust query | | | +----> Capabilities <------+ (intel_dp_link_caps.c) ^ | adjust/query | Fallback (intel_dp_link_training.c) - Ensure consistent link configuration ordering across computation and fallback phases. - Add detailed documentation and test coverage for the link capabilities interface and the link recovery logic. Patchset layout: This is a large series because the interfaces and state tracking for link-state computation, fallback, and recovery are intertwined across multiple modules. They also rely on direct access to, and mutation of, state instead of a proper interface, so untangling this was involved. Nevertheless, most changes are mechanical code movement and renaming: separating link training and link capability handling from the generic DP code and moving them into dedicated modules. A large part of both the link training and link caps portions of this series follows the same idea: 1. Move existing helpers accessing link training or link caps state. 2. Add new helpers for accessing that state, converting all direct users to use them. 3. Move the state to be internal to the respective module. Later parts (notably the link capability module) depend on earlier refactoring of link training. The rationale for submitting all the changes in a single patchset is twofold: 1. The last segment, adding the link capability interface, requires all previous refactoring to both generic DP and link training code. 2. The purpose of much of the earlier refactoring only becomes clear in the context of the last segment adding the link capability interface. All intermediate steps in those segments prepare for the introduction of the link capability interface, which at the end connects link-capability detection, -state computation and -fallback/recovery functionality in a unified way. The series is therefore kept as a single unit, but organized into the following segments of patches to allow incremental review and merging: - Link training refactoring: 1-26 - Link capabilities
